Position Summary:

  • The Travelling Housemanager will support an Ultra High Net Worth Family, consisting of The Chairman and six Principals, by managing international travel logistics and administrative operations. The role requires a highly organised, discreet, and proactive individual capable of overseeing property transitions, staff coordination, procurement, and financial reporting across multiple international locations.
  • When not travelling, the Supervisor will be based in Riyadh, working closely with the Operations Manager and the company Directors along with the travel team, overseeing projects both in The Kingdom and internationally.

Roles and Responsibilities

Key Responsibilities:

  • Location Management & Travel Logistics
  • The advance takeover and hand back of rental properties, including private residences, hotels, and yachts.
  • Ensure all locations are fully prepared and set up to meet the family’s requirements prior to arrival.
  • Implement and monitor travel policy compliance for the Chairman and Principals.
  • Coordinate the recruitment, onboarding, and readiness of location-specific seasonal staff.
  • Manage procurement of goods and services from trusted providers, ensuring timely delivery and cost-efficiency.
  • Conduct cost analysis and apply measures to optimise expenditure without compromising standards.
  • Liaise with service providers to ensure all arrangements are executed to the highest level of quality and discretion.

.

Administrative Support:

  • Assist the International Operations Manager in all aspects of travel planning and execution.
  • Monitor and control travel budgets; produce weekly financial reports for the Chairman and the Financial Team in Riyadh.
  • Record and manage all purchase receipts and invoices; maintain a centralised database accessible to key stakeholders.
  • Serve as the primary administrative contact for all staff and guests involved in international travel operations.
  • Conduct detailed research into holiday options, itineraries, and bespoke travel requests for the Chairman and Principals.
  • Maintain operational checklists, schedules, and contingency plans to ensure smooth execution of all travel-related activities.
